    • This document discusses, among other things, an apparatus for painting a work surface including a handle housing. A disposable painting module is configured to be removably engaged with the handle housing. The painting module includes a paint applicator configured to be removably engaged with the handle housing. The paint applicator is configured to apply paint to the work surface. A paint reservoir is fluidly coupled with the paint applicator and is configured to be removably engaged with the handle housing. An urging mechanism is coupled to the handle housing and configured to interact with the paint reservoir to substantially uniformly discharge the paint from the paint reservoir and supply the paint to the paint applicator.

    • A drug delivery device includes a housing with a base and a cover that define an enclosure. A drug container disposed within the enclosure includes a drug reservoir configured to retain the drug therein. The drug container includes external features formed on an exterior of the drug container configured to interface with the housing so as to allow for dynamic movement relative to the housing to relieve stress on the rigid or flexible drug container when the needle assembly is actuated between the engaged and unengaged configurations. The drug delivery device includes a needle assembly with a needle and a drug channel connected between the drug container and needle assembly. A needle actuation mechanism is coupled to the needle assembly and actuatable between an engaged configuration and an unengaged configuration. The needle is extended from the housing in the engaged configuration and retracted in the housing in the unengaged configuration.

    • The present disclosure relates to penile implants that are easier to implant and reduce trauma because they provide for a smaller effective width during implantation, after implantation, or both. The present disclosure also provides for a shorter tubing junction while reducing effective width, further reducing trauma to the body. In a first aspect, the penile implant includes a tubing junction that is smaller in effective diameter while implanted in the body. The penile implant includes an axially extending cylinder having an inflation chamber and a rear tip. The cylinder also includes a tubing junction disposed between the inflation chamber and rear tip and extending from the cylinder. The tubing junction includes a bore in fluid communication with the inflation chamber. In one example, this bore is in the strain relief of the tubing junction. The bore is configured to include a compound curve. In another aspect, the penile implant includes a tubing junction that can assume a smaller effective diameter while being implanted into the body. The surgeon is able to press the tubing against the cylinder than the related art to reduce the effective area of the penile implant. This penile implant includes a cylinder having an inflation chamber and a rear tip. A tubing junction is disposed between the inflation chamber and the rear tip. The tubing junction includes a strain relief that extends from the cylinder and forms an acute area proximate the intersection of the cylinder and the strain relief. The acute area includes a keyhole.
